Rutgers-Camden Baseball Shuts Out Rowan, 11-0

Box Score GLASSBORO, NJ – The Rutgers-Camden baseball team shut out Rowan University, 11-0 in a New Jersey Athletic Conference (NJAC) game on Thursday.
 
The Scarlet Raptors are 16-6 overall and in first place of the conference with a 6-1 mark.  The Profs have a 19-5 record and they are 3-4 in the NJAC.
 
Right-hander Ian Scheidemann (jr. Cherry Hill, NJ/Cherry Hill W.)pitched a complete game for his fifth win and second shutout on the season.  He (5-0) only gave up five hits and had six strikeouts. Righty Andrew Cartier (jr. Estell Manor, NJ/Buena Reg.) suffered his first loss (2-1) on the mound.
 
Second baseman Chris Jones (jr. Washington Twp., NJ/Bishop Eustace Prep) paced Rutgers-Camden with three hits (five at bats), three RBIs, two doubles and two runs.  Left fielder John Tedeschi (so. Haddonfield, NJ/Haddonfield Mem.) contributed with two hits, three RBIs and a triple.  First baseman R.J. Concepcion (fr. Audubon, NJ/Audubon) totaled three hits in four at bats, two RBIs and two runs.  
 
Catcher Tyler Travis (so. Berlin, NJ/Eastern Reg.) chipped in with three hits and one run.  Outfielder Billy Eisler (fr. Pennsauken, NJ/Camden Catholic) added two hits and two runs.  Designated hitter Matt Yanick (so. Palmyra, NJ/Palmyra) produced a double, one RBI and one run.  Right fielder Brandon Cornelius (sr. Sicklerville, NJ/Timber Creek Reg.) crossed the plate twice and third baseman Matthew Stoots (so. Browns Mills, NJ/Pemberton) scored one time.  
 
For the Profs, second baseman Alex Kokos (so. Wayne, NJ/Wayne Valley) had two hits in four trips to the plate.  Right fielder Kyle Golla (sr. Palm Coast, FL/Allentown (NJ)) registered a double.
 
The Scarlet Raptors had a 5-0 lead after one run in the second inning and four in the third. They broke the game open with a six-run eighth inning.
 
Rowan plays Rutgers-Camden again on Friday, April 13 at 3:30 p.m. at Campbell's Field in Camden.
